Cluster for beam dynamics error studies

Description

The need for computing power for the dynamics of intense beams is growing. The error studies required to determine an accelerator sensitivity to imperfections call for calculations that are increasingly heavy (memory), long (CPU time) and numerous (statistics). Today, many laboratories are developing a more economical approach than supercomputers. It involves linking PCs via a network, whether dedicated or not. Together, they form a cluster. Depending on the software used to manage the cluster, parallel or multi-parameter computing can be distributed across this farm of PCs. The economic argument is obvious, and can be taken to extremes by using only machines already in the park. There's no need to spend a single penny on hardware. The use of office PCs at night and at weekends makes sense for multi-parameter calculations, which are made up of numerous processes, each relatively resource-efficient. As the accelerator error study falls into this category, the development of a cluster using the local LAN network was carried out at SACM. This report details the principles of the software layer that manages the cluster: client/server architecture, the TraceWin interface for client management
